Common pest control problems we fix in Barrett Junction

A smell and noise from the attic that keeps coming back

Contaminated insulation keeps drawing new animals in by scent long after the first ones are gone. Exclusion, clean-out and sanitation go together.

Bees going in and out of a wall or chimney

A colony inside a cavity leaves comb and honey behind even after the bees are gone, which draws robbing bees, beetles and staining if it is not removed.

Mounds and dying patches across a lawn or grove

Gophers, and the damage usually surfaces well away from the active run, so treating the mounds themselves is wasted effort.

A dark spider with a red hourglass in the garage

Black widows favour undisturbed voids - planters, block walls, meter boxes, irrigation boxes. Clearing the webs without treating the harbourage just resets the clock.

Small pellet piles on a sill, floor or countertop

Drywood termite frass, pushed out of kick-out holes. The colony is inside the timber with no soil contact, which is a different treatment to subterranean work.

Are you licensed to do termite work?

Yes. Structural pest control in California is licensed by the Structural Pest Control Board, which separates Branch 1 fumigation, Branch 2 general pest and Branch 3 termite work. We carry the branch licence for the work we perform and the documentation is available before we start.

Do I have to tent for termites?

Not always. Whole-structure fumigation is for widespread drywood infestation. Where the activity is localised, spot treatment, foam or orange oil can be enough. The inspection decides it - anyone quoting a tent before looking is guessing.

What is the difference between drywood and subterranean termites?

Drywood termites live inside the timber itself and are the common problem along the coast. Subterranean termites need soil contact and build mud tubes up into the structure, and they dominate inland from Escondido out through Temecula and Hemet. The treatments are completely different.
